So far, more than 3,500 organisations have signed up to support the campaign. It’s a terrific achievement. We estimated more than 100,000 health professionals are taking part in one way or another and will directly influence in excess of five million patients across the UK.

It’s the 40th National Smile Month, and it’s wonderful to see the campaign going from strength-to-strength.
